Motor Yacht KALIMERA, a 31.1-metre vessel from Cantieri di Pisa, offers journeys through the East Mediterranean. Launched in 2003 and refitted in 2025, she accommodates 10 guests across 5 cabins, supported by a crew of 6. Her 7.1-metre beam provides generous spaces for relaxation and enjoyment. Equipped with air conditioning, Wi-Fi, and light fishing gear, KALIMERA is designed for comfortable and engaging experiences on the water. Ownership economics

What a yacht like KALIMERA costs to own — not just to charter

The published weekly rate for KALIMERA is the base charter fee, not an all-in total. APA, taxes, repositioning and itinerary-specific services are confirmed separately. Ownership of a 31m yacht in this class is a five-year commitment — crew payroll, insurance, class and refit reserves, berthing and depreciation.
